Pilates from home may boost walking and mood in MS patients
Symptom relief Not yet recruitingThis study will test whether a 16-week Pilates program done at home via video calls can improve walking, balance, fatigue, and pain in people with multiple sclerosis (MS). Nostalgia may get seniors moving: new study tests power of memories to boost walking
Knowledge-focused Not yet recruitingThis study tests whether nostalgic messages sent to a mobile app can encourage adults aged 65-74 to walk more. 1,000 participants will receive daily messages for two weeks, with some also tracking their steps.
